Overall Meaning

The song "Crush" by Willard Grant Conspiracy talks about the feelings of a person who has a crush on someone. The lyrics describe how this person doesn't want to overanalyze their attraction to the other person or make a big deal out of it. They suggest playing it loose and not putting too much pressure on the situation, as they don't have a "date with destiny." The chorus emphasizes that it's just a little crush, not something that controls everything they do.


The song also hints at the fear of rejection, as the singer doesn't want to hear the word "forevermore" and can only commit to "maybe." They worry that the other person might make too much of their actions or words and take it as a sign of something more serious. The final line of the chorus - "Not like everything I do depends on you" - reaffirms that this crush isn't the center of their world.


The images of "vanilla skies" and "white picket fences" suggest a stereotypical, idealized love story, but the singer acknowledges that it's just a vision and not necessarily reality. Overall, "Crush" is a song about the excitement and uncertainty of having a crush, and trying not to let it take over one's life.
